Police have said they are investigating a "racially aggravated" rape in the West Midlands.
Officers were called just before 8.30am on Tuesday after a Sikh woman in her 20s reported being attacked by two white men in the area around Tame Road in Oldbury. The Sikh Federation (UK) said the perpetrators allegedly told the woman during the attack: "You don't belong in this country, get out." One of the men is described as having a shaved head, of heavy build, and was reported to be wearing a dark coloured sweatshirt and gloves.
The second man was reportedly wearing a grey top with a silver zip. West Midland Police said it is being treated as a "racially aggravated attack" and has appealed for anyone in the area who may have seen the men to contact the force.
Chief Superintendent Kim Madill said: "We are working really hard to identify those responsible, with CCTV, forensic and other enquiries well under way. "We fully understand the anger and worry that this has caused, and I am speaking to people in the community today to reassure them that we are doing everything we can to identify and arrest those responsible.
"Incidents like this are incredibly rare, but people can expect to see extra patrols in the area." Dabinderjit Singh, the lead executive for political engagement at the Sikh Federation (UK), said: "The current racist political environment is driven by popularism and created by politicians playing the anti-immigration card who are unashamedly exploiting those with right-wing and racist views. "More than 48 hours later we await the public condemnation by politicians on all sides of this brutal racist and sexual attack where a young Sikh woman has been viciously beaten and raped." Gurinder Singh Josan, Labour MP for Smethwick, wrote on X: "This is a truly horrific attack and my thoughts are with the victim." He added: "The incidence is being treated as a hate crime.
"The police are working extremely sympathetically with the victim at her pace who has been traumatised by the attack. "We are grateful for all the CCTV and information that has already been forthcoming from the community.".
